Silves
Most of the town and nearly all its ancient buildings were destroyed
by the earthquake of 1755. The impressive remains of the castle
dates back to Moors and there is a impressive underground water
reservoir that is still used by the city today. It has the romantic
name of “ Cistern of the Enchanted Moorish Girl” and was said to
be a principal factor in the fall of the town during its siege.
The Museu Arqueológico has been constructed above the cistern
and here a visitor will find exhibits of locally found objects included
items from the Stone Age. As a reminder of the Romans occupation is the Ponte Romana, a fine strong bridge over the
Rio Arade below the city walls and rebuilt from the original
in the 15th Century. The city’s earlier 13th
Century Cathedral was built on the site of a Mosque and has suffered
considerable alteration over the centuries. Tothe southwest side
of the town is a modern statue celebrating the siege of 1189 in
an appropriately named square, Largo dos Mártires, where
it is suggested that the defending Moors were buried. Just to the
northeast of the city is a fascinating 16th Century granite
cross that is located beside the road to the north. The countryside
around Silves is the biggest orange growing area in Portugal
and other neighboring towns share in the economic benefits from
this product. There has been a popular recent decision to site a
new University in Silves to recreate its links with its past.
